Where Can I Sell A Puppy Online

Are you looking to sell a puppy online but don't know where to start? With the rise of e-commerce and online marketplaces, there are now more options than ever for selling puppies online. From dedicated pet websites to social media platforms, the possibilities are endless. In this article, we will explore where you can sell a puppy online, as well as some interesting trends in the industry.

One of the most popular places to sell a puppy online is through dedicated pet websites such as PuppyFind, AKC Marketplace, and NextDayPets. These websites allow breeders and sellers to create listings for their puppies, complete with photos, descriptions, and prices. Buyers can then browse through the listings and contact sellers directly to make a purchase. These websites are a great way to reach a large audience of potential buyers and are often used by reputable breeders.

Another option for selling a puppy online is through social media platforms such as Facebook and Instagram. Many breeders and sellers use these platforms to showcase their puppies and connect with potential buyers. By posting photos and videos of the puppies, as well as sharing information about their breed, temperament, and health history, sellers can attract interested buyers. Social media platforms also allow for direct communication between buyers and sellers, making it easy to finalize a sale.

In addition to dedicated pet websites and social media platforms, there are also online marketplaces such as Craigslist and eBay where puppies can be sold. These platforms are less regulated than dedicated pet websites and social media platforms, so buyers should exercise caution when purchasing a puppy from these sites. However, they can still be a good option for sellers looking to reach a wider audience.

Now, let's address some common concerns and questions related to selling puppies online:

1. Are online marketplaces safe for selling puppies?

While online marketplaces can be a convenient way to reach a wider audience, buyers should exercise caution when purchasing a puppy from these sites. It's important to do thorough research on the seller, ask for references, and visit the breeder's facilities in person if possible.

2. How can I ensure that my puppy is healthy and well-cared for before purchasing online?

Before purchasing a puppy online, ask the seller for documentation of the puppy's health history, including vaccinations, deworming, and vet check-ups. You can also request to see the breeder's facilities and meet the puppy's parents to ensure that they are well-cared for.

3. What should I look for in a reputable breeder when buying a puppy online?

When buying a puppy online, look for breeders who prioritize the health and welfare of their puppies, offer health guarantees, and are transparent about their breeding practices. It's also important to ask for references and visit the breeder's facilities in person if possible.

4. How can I avoid scams when buying a puppy online?

To avoid scams when buying a puppy online, be wary of sellers who ask for payment upfront, refuse to provide documentation of the puppy's health history, or offer prices that seem too good to be true. It's important to do thorough research on the seller and ask for references before making a purchase.
